Output d07db0b23ff75673d1c772a81211423d5825af4ffda9fea3e29525c63d8acbb6:1

value
8805272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a8c6e06b777e8114019edaf75def48d3c2095a OP_EQUAL
address
MDFKcNtrbmdkPVS444B8KpPzTsCFRqswB8
transaction
d07db0b23ff75673d1c772a81211423d5825af4ffda9fea3e29525c63d8acbb6
spent
true